Why is GeForce RTX 2060 SUPER better than GeForce RTX 2070?

The GeForce RTX 2060 SUPER and RTX 2070 are virtually identical in performance, both featuring 8GB of VRAM and the Turing architecture. In almost every benchmark, the two cards trade blows, with the 2060 SUPER often matching the 2070 thanks to its improved core specs released later in the generation. Both provide a great highnd 1080p or smooth 1440p experience.

Technically, the RTX 2070 has a very minor lead in raw core count, but for the average user, the difference is imperceivable. Because they offer the same level of performance and nearly identical features, the winner is usually whichever card you can find for a better price. Both remain excellent entries into the world of Ray Tracing and DLSS on the secondary market, providing a robust platform for modern gaming on a budget.

Technical Specifications

Side-by-side comparison of GeForce RTX 2070 and GeForce RTX 2060 SUPER

NVIDIA

GeForce RTX 2070

The GeForce RTX 2070 is manufactured by NVIDIA. It was released in October 17 2018. It features the Turing architecture. The core clock ranges from 1410 MHz to 1620 MHz. It has 2304 shading units. The thermal design power (TDP) is 175W. Manufactured using 12 nm process technology. It features 36 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 16,068 points. Launch price was $499.

NVIDIA

GeForce RTX 2060 SUPER

The GeForce RTX 2060 SUPER is manufactured by NVIDIA. It was released in July 9 2019. It features the Turing architecture. The core clock ranges from 1470 MHz to 1650 MHz. It has 2176 shading units. The thermal design power (TDP) is 175W. Manufactured using 12 nm process technology. It features 34 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 16,477 points. Launch price was $399.

Graphics Performance

The GeForce RTX 2070 scores 16,068 and the GeForce RTX 2060 SUPER reaches 16,477 in the G3D Mark benchmark — just a 2.5% difference, making them near-identical in rasterization performance. The GeForce RTX 2070 is built on Turing while the GeForce RTX 2060 SUPER uses Turing, both on a 12 nm process. Shader units: 2,304 (GeForce RTX 2070) vs 2,176 (GeForce RTX 2060 SUPER). Raw compute: 7.465 TFLOPS (GeForce RTX 2070) vs 7.181 TFLOPS (GeForce RTX 2060 SUPER). Boost clocks: 1620 MHz vs 1650 MHz. Ray tracing: 36 RT cores (GeForce RTX 2070) vs 34 (GeForce RTX 2060 SUPER) with 288 Tensor cores vs 272.

Video Memory (VRAM)

Both cards feature 8 GB of GDDR6. Bus width: 256-bit vs 256-bit.

Display & API Support

DirectX support: 12.1 (GeForce RTX 2070) vs 12 Ultimate (GeForce RTX 2060 SUPER). Vulkan: 1.3 vs 1.3. OpenGL: 4.6 vs 4.6. Maximum simultaneous displays: 4 vs 4.

Media & Encoding

Hardware encoder: NVENC 6.0 (GeForce RTX 2070) vs NVENC 7th Gen (GeForce RTX 2060 SUPER). Decoder: PureVideo HD VP9 vs NVDEC 4th Gen. Supported codecs: MPEG-2,H.264,HEVC,VP9 (GeForce RTX 2070) vs H.264,H.265,VP9,VP8 (GeForce RTX 2060 SUPER).

Power & Dimensions

The GeForce RTX 2070 draws 175W versus the GeForce RTX 2060 SUPER's 175W — a 0% difference. The GeForce RTX 2060 SUPER is more power-efficient. Recommended PSU: 550W (GeForce RTX 2070) vs 550W (GeForce RTX 2060 SUPER). Power connectors: 8-pin vs 8-pin. Card length: 267mm vs 229mm, occupying 2 vs 2 slots. Typical load temperature: 80°C vs 70.

Value Analysis

The GeForce RTX 2070 launched at $599 MSRP and currently averages $180, while the GeForce RTX 2060 SUPER launched at $399 and now averages $160. The GeForce RTX 2060 SUPER costs 11.1% less ($20 savings) at current market prices. Performance per dollar (G3D Mark / price): 89.3 (GeForce RTX 2070) vs 103.0 (GeForce RTX 2060 SUPER) — the GeForce RTX 2060 SUPER offers 15.3% better value. The GeForce RTX 2060 SUPER is the newer GPU (2019 vs 2018).
